DETAILED DESCRIPTION OF THE INVENTION [Field of Industrial Application] The present invention relates to a riding-type rice transplanter.

Previously, Utility Model Application No. 52-59613 and Utility Model Application No. 54-
There was a rice transplanter for odd number row planting as shown in Publication No. 25422.

In the conventional odd-row rice transplanter mentioned above,
The left side of the machine has a transmission case with a seedling planting device on only one side, and the right side has a transmission case with seedling planting devices on both sides. The weight balance was very poor and it was not practical.

This invention has taken the following technical measures for the purpose of solving the problems of the conventional rice transplanter described above.

That is, the planting portion transmission case 7 is provided with left and right transmission cases 9, 11 extending rearward and a middle transmission case 10, and the left and right transmission cases 9, 11 are provided with seedling planting devices 14, 15, on both left and right sides, respectively. 16 and 17, and a seedling planting device 18 is provided only on one side of the middle transmission case 10 to form a configuration for five-row planting.

In this invention, seedling planting devices 14, 15, 1 are provided on the left and right sides of each of the left and right transmission cases 9, 11.
6 and 17, and the seedling planting device 18 is provided only on one side of the middle transmission case 10, making it a riding type rice transplanter for planting 5 rows, so the weight balance in the left and right direction is very good. 5. Good planting performance that can solve the problems of rice transplanters that plant in odd rows.
A riding type rice transplanter for row planting can be obtained.

An embodiment of the present invention will be described in detail with reference to the drawings. Reference numeral 1 denotes a passenger vehicle body, and left and right front wheels 2, 2 for steering are provided at the lower front side, and left and right rear wheels 3, 3 are provided at the lower rear side to be driven and rotated. , there is a control handle 4 on the top of the aircraft.
It also has a pilot seat 5.

Reference numeral 6 denotes a rice-transplanting work machine for 5-row planting, and a planting part transmission case 7 that also serves as the frame projects from a main transmission case 8 at the front and from this main transmission case 8 at a predetermined left and right interval. left and right transmission case 9,
11, and a middle transmission case 10. 1
Reference numeral 2 denotes a seedling tank, which is supported above the main transmission case 8 with the front side facing upward, and is provided so as to be reciprocated from side to side by a reciprocating mechanism 13.

Reference numerals 14, 15, 16, 17, and 18 are seedling planting devices, respectively, and the seedling planting devices 14, 15, 16, and 17 are provided on both sides of each of the left and right transmission cases 9 and 11, and Seedling planting device 1 on one side
8 are provided and their seedling planting devices 14,1
Each of the planting claws fixed to the front ends of the seedlings 5, 16, 17, and 18 is configured to operate while drawing a loop-shaped seedling planting locus vertically and downwardly.

The seedling planting device 18 is provided so that its planting claws are located on the left-right center line A of the rice-transplanting machine 6.

19 is a link for lifting and lowering, the base of which is connected to the passenger vehicle body 1;
The rolling support shaft 20 is pivotally attached to the rear of the
A rice transplanting work machine 6 is mounted so as to be able to roll freely.

The planting claw portion of the seedling planting device 18 is located on the axial extension line of the rolling support shaft 20, and the planting position thereof is located on the rolling center line A.

In addition, 21 is a center leveling float, and 22 and 23 are side leveling floats, which are installed below the planting unit transmission case so that the front part can move up and down with the rear part as a fulcrum. It is provided to level the soil surface in front of the planting position of the planting device.

In the configuration of the above example, after seedlings are placed and accommodated in the seedling tank 12, the riding rice transplanter is moved forward while driving each part.

Then, the rice transplanting machine 6 is pulled by the soil leveling floats 21, 22, 23 floating on the topsoil surface of the field.
The seedling tank 12 moves back and forth horizontally to the left and right to place and store the seedlings in each seedling planting device 14, 15, 16, 17, 18.
supply to The seedlings supplied in this way are separated and held one by one by each seedling planting device 14, 15, 16, 17, 18, and transported downward to the land leveling float 2.
Planted on the leveled soil surface in steps 1, 22, and 23. In this way, the seedling planting work is carried out, but during the work, the operator needs to be careful about straight-line operation so that the management and reaping work after planting the seedlings can be done easily and accurately. In fields with sandy soil, it is difficult to operate in a straight line, so the operator sets an appropriate target on the ridge in front of him and steers towards it. You have to look back and check whether you are doing it correctly, and you often lose sight of your target. At this time, the pilot looks at the rows of seedlings that have been planted up to that point and reestablishes an accurate target for maneuvering, but in this case,
It is required that the seedling rows to be planted later are reliably planted without meandering.

However, the row of seedlings planted by the seedling planting device 18 immediately after the pilot's seat 5 is on the rolling center line A, and the center of gravity shifts due to the left and right movement of the seedling tank 12, and the undulations of the soil surface cause the rice planting work to be difficult. Even when the machine 6 rolls, only the rows of seedlings in the center of the left and right sides meander and are not planted properly, so the operator sets the target based on the row of seedlings located in the center of the left and right sides. This enables accurate straight-line operation of the riding rice transplanter.

In particular, seedling planting devices 14, 15, 1 are provided on the left and right sides of the left and right transmission cases 9 and 11, respectively.
6 and 17, and the medium transmission case 10 is provided with a seedling planting device 18 only on one side, making it a five-row rice transplanting work machine 6, so that the weight balance in the left and right direction is very good for planting. The adhesion performance is extremely good.
